Chief Michel Moore to Step Down from LAPD Leadership
On January 16, 2024, Los Angeles Police Department (LAPD) Chief Michel Moore made the significant announcement that he will resign from his position at the end of February 2024. Having served as Chief since 2018, Moore has been at the helm during pivotal moments for both the department and the city, demonstrating a commitment to reform and community engagement.

Chief Moore’s Reflections on His Tenure
In his statement regarding his resignation, Chief Moore reflected on his time with the LAPD, expressing gratitude for the opportunity to lead the department. He noted, “It has been an honor to lead the men and women of the LAPD. I am proud of the progress we’ve made and believe the department is well-positioned to continue serving and protecting the people of Los Angeles.” His remarks highlight both his pride in tangible achievements and optimism for the future direction of the department.
Mayor Karen Bass’s Acknowledgment of Chief Moore
Mayor Karen Bass also recognized Chief Moore’s contributions, emphasizing the impact of his four decades of public service in Los Angeles. She stated, “Chief Moore has dedicated over four decades to public service in Los Angeles. We will work diligently to identify a new leader who will build upon his legacy and continue advancing public safety in our city.” This acknowledgment underscores the importance of strong leadership in navigating evolving public safety concerns.
